Document Description
The California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) proposes realigning a 1.8 mile segment of U.S. Highway 395 from post mile 117.8 to post mile 119.6 along Topaz Lake. The project would correct several curves and dips, widen the shoulders to 8 feet, construct retaining walls, and construct catchment areas below the cut slopes to keep rocks and debris off the highway.
